Hans-Dieter Haas/ Susanne Lindemann, München
Knowledge intensive business services (KIBS) as regional
innovation system
Pages 1 - 14
The number of business enterprises in a particular region
represents a location factor that reflects the ability to develop a regional
innovation system. Specialization resulting in branches equipped with
pertinent, intensive know-how and the degree of intensity of the knowledge
of these branches provide significant hints about the extent of specialized
information present as well as about the potential for transferring knowledge
within company networks. By identifying branches endowed with concentrated
knowledge and by analyzing cases of specialization in a region, the contribution
in hand offers an initial indication about the quantification of creative
environments.
